Phorcys dubei
Taxonomy
Phorcys dubei was named by Kammerer and Rubidge (2022). It is not extant. Its type specimen is BP/1/5851, a partial skull (ear portion of a skull broken off at the level of the orbits and missing the left temporal arch).
